Went to my Buddys fab shop and built this Killer bumper last night.  It has the big empty spot for a winch when I can afford one, soon I hope.  It is made out of 1 1/2 pipe, pretty stout.  Here are some pics of the build.

Extending the frame rails.


Test fit the Stinger.


Starting the grill surround.


The final product.


Another view.
